Für Displaylängen über 8 Zeichen pro Zeile benötigt man normalerweise zusätzliche Displaytreiber (HD44100). Um diese Kosten zu sparen, werden oft einfach die beiden Zeilen eines 2x8 Displays mechanisch hintereinander angeordnet (8+8-Modul). Der Controller weiß davon nichts, und behandelt die vordere und die hintere Displayhälfte wie zwei getrennte Zeilen. Deshalb muß der Controller auch 2-zeilig initialisiert werden.

....Es gibt gelegentlich auch echte 1x16-Displays mit nur einer logischen Zeile. Diese sollten auch nur einzeilig initialisiert werden. Was für einen Typ man besitzt, stellt sich spätestens nach der Initialisierung heraus. Befindet sich auf der Displayrückseite aber nur ein Chip (der Controller HD44780) dann handelt es sich höchstwarscheinlich um ein 8+8-Modul. Befindet sich dort aber noch ein zweiter Chip (ein Displaytreiber HD44100), dann arbeitet das Display einzeilig mit 16 Zeichen pro Zeile.....


mensch leute "google...lol...

www.sprut.de/electronic/lcd/